How to clean sandbox


Prepare tools


Shovel: used to remove debris and lumps of sand in the sand pit.
Rake: can rake the sand flat and also help to clean out some small debris.
Broom: used to sweep the dust and small debris on the edges and corners of the sand pit.
Sieve: choose a sieve of appropriate size according to the size of the sand pit to filter out small stones, leaves and other impurities in the sand.
Garbage bag: used to hold the cleaned garbage.

Sand pit cleaning steps


1. First, use a shovel to shovel out large debris in the sand pit, such as branches, leaves, plastic garbage, etc., and put them into a garbage bag. If there is a lot of accumulated water, you need to scoop out the water first or use a pumping device to drain it.


2. Use a rake to loosen the sand in the sand pit, which will help with subsequent cleaning work and also disperse the lumps of sand.


3. Filter the sand through a sieve to separate small stones, clods of soil and other fine impurities. You can screen them step by step in different areas to ensure that the sand in each place is cleaned.


4. Use a broom to carefully sweep the edges and corners of the sand pit, where dust and fine debris are likely to accumulate. Sweep the swept garbage together and shovel it into a garbage bag with a shovel.


5. Check the amount of sand and, if necessary, add new sand appropriately to maintain the appropriate height of the sand pit. Then use a rake to rake the sand flat to create a flat and clean sand pit surface.

How to keep a sandbox clean


1. In order to keep the sand pit clean, it is recommended to clean it regularly. The frequency can be determined according to the usage and environmental conditions. Generally, it is more appropriate to clean it once a week or every two weeks.


2. After each use of the sand pit, clean up the debris left by tourists in time, which can reduce the workload of large-scale cleaning.


3. Consider setting up fences or covers around the sand pit to prevent surrounding dust, leaves and other debris from entering the sand pit, and also prevent animals from defecating or digging in the sand pit.

Importance of keeping sandboxes clean


Preventing infection


If sandboxes are not clean, harmful microorganisms such as bacteria, viruses and parasites may breed in them. If children do not pay attention to hygiene after playing in sandboxes, they may develop skin allergies, respiratory infections and other diseases.


Avoid injuries


If there are debris in the sand pit, such as glass fragments, wires, sharp branches, etc., it may cause injuries to users, such as cuts and punctures.


Provide a good playing experience


Clean sand is soft and fine, with good fluidity and plasticity, and children can easily use sand to build castles, dig tunnels, etc.

A clean sand pit has no odor and dust, which can create a comfortable playing environment for users. On the contrary, unclean sand pits may emit unpleasant odors, and the dust raised will also affect the air quality and make people feel uncomfortable.


Prevent sand from deteriorating


Cleaning the sand pit regularly to avoid the accumulation of debris and moisture in the sand pit can prevent the sand from deteriorating. If the sand is wet for a long time, it loses its original soft properties, and the sand needs to be replaced more frequently with a dry sand pit.


Protect the sand pit


Keeping the environment around the sand pit clean helps prevent corrosion and damage to sand pit facilities such as frames and fences.Keeping the sand pit clean is important for protecting the health and safety of users, providing a good playing experience, and extending the service life of the sand pit.
